Responding to an Alert
When the analyzer experiences a problem, an alert message appears on the upper right side of the
IDEXX VetLab Station title bar, the LED on the front panel of the Catalyst One analyzer flashes red,
and the Catalyst One icon on the IDEXX VetLab Station Home screen appears with an Alert status.
To View an Alert
Do one of the following:
Tap the Catalyst One icon on the IDEXX VetLab Station Home screen.
Tap the alert message in the title bar to display the alert message. Follow the instructions
displayed in the alert message.
Installing the Catalyst One Analyzer
The Catalyst One analyzer works in conjunction with the IDEXX VetLab Station.
To Install the Catalyst One Analyzer
1. Before you unpack the analyzer, choose an optimum location for the instrument. The analyzer
should be placed on a level surface in a well-ventilated area away from obvious sources of
heat, direct sunlight, cold, humidity, or vibrations. For optimum results, room temperature
should be at 1C30°C (59°F–86°F) and relative humidity at 15%–75%.
IMPORTANT: Ensure proper ventilation. The analyzer’s cooling vents are in the base and the
back.
2. Connect the analyzer to the router:
If you are planning to connect the device wirelessly to an IDEXX VetLab* Station,
proceed to step 3 (wireless-capable router required).
OR
If you are connecting the device to an IDEXX VetLab Station using a wired router,
connect the device to a numbered port on the router using an Ethernet cable
(provided).
Note: For more information about connecting your analyzer to the router, see the installation
instructions that accompanied your router.
3. Power on the Catalyst One analyzer. Once the Catalyst One icon displays on the IDEXX
VetLab Station Home screen, your connections are complete.
Note: If the Catalyst One icon does not appear on the IDEXX VetLab Station Home screen
within 3 minutes, contact IDEXX Technical Support for assistance.
